  18. Hi Anya I am so sorry that you have a reason to be here. But you will find members here have a wealth of information and are very supportive. Some Oncologist will give you a timeframe and other's will not. Personally I would not believe it anyway. I was given a timeframe for both my Mother and my Brother. Neither were even close. You will read stories on here of members given a few months but are here years later. No one has an expiry date stamped on the bottom of their foot for the Oncologist to read. Oncologist giving timeframes are just going by statistics. Those stats can include people of all ages, different illnesses, etc. Also people react differently to treatment. I would say just enjoy the time you have whether it is months or years. Please come back and let us help support you on this journey. Take care.

  23. Hi Amy Thanks for dropping in again. Alot of us have went through what you are feeling now. The fear of reoccurance is always there but it gets easier with time. For me it has been 6 years now and it is there in the back of your mind but not your main focus like it was in the beginning. I understand how watching your Uncle go through things can add to that fear. I lost my Uncle, Mother, and Brother to lung cancer. So you can imagine what was going through my mind when I was told that I had lung cancer ! After talking to others, asking questions, doing research, etc. I found that you are an indiviual and everyone is different and responds differently to treatment. You are fortunate that it was caught early. That is why I would tell someone not to compare yourself to someone else or to read statistics. As you progress on this journey, you will find there is hope and your confidence will grow. The emotional challenge is just as hard if not worse than the physical challenge especially in the beginning. We have been there and whether it was therapy, medication, etc. they are all for assistance in helping on this journey. Take care.
